Ingredients for Tortilla Cinnamon Rolls

Flour tortillas: The base for the rolls, these tortillas provide the perfect soft, yet slightly crisp exterior. You can use gluten-free tortillas, regular flour tortillas, or even paleo tortillas for a healthier option.
Cream cheese: The creamy filling that forms the heart of the roll-up. Use regular or vegan cream cheese for a non-dairy version.
Coconut sugar: Adds sweetness with a mild caramel flavor. This ingredient is perfect for those who want a healthier alternative to regular sugar.
Cinnamon: The classic spice that gives these rolls their signature flavor. It adds warmth and depth to each bite.
Butter: For cooking the roll-ups to golden perfection. You can use vegan butter, regular butter, or even ghee for a richer flavor.
Maple syrup: For dipping the rolls, giving them a sweet, irresistible finish.

How to Make Tortilla Cinnamon Rolls

  1. Prepare the cinnamon sugar mixture: In a small bowl, mix coconut sugar and cinnamon. Set aside for later use.
  2. Warm the tortillas: Place the tortillas on a stovetop for a few seconds on low heat to make them flexible.
  3. Spread the cream cheese: Evenly spread a generous layer of cream cheese on each tortilla.
  4. Add the cinnamon sugar: Sprinkle the cinnamon sugar mixture generously over the cream cheese layer.
  5. Roll the tortillas: Carefully roll up the tortillas, making sure they are tightly wrapped.
  6. Cook the rolls: Heat butter in a pan over medium-low heat. Once the butter has melted, add the rolled-up tortillas and cook for 2–3 minutes per side until golden and crispy.
  7. Coat with cinnamon sugar: Once the rolls are cooked, dip them in the remaining cinnamon sugar mixture to coat the outside.
  8. Serve with maple syrup: Serve warm with a side of maple syrup for dipping.

Tips & Tricks for the Best Tortilla Cinnamon Rolls

  • Don’t overheat the tortillas: Gently warm the tortillas just enough to make them pliable. Overheating can cause them to break when rolling.
  • Crisp them to perfection: Be sure to cook the rolls on medium-low heat to get the perfect golden-brown crust.
  • Check doneness: As you cook, keep an eye on the rolls, making sure they’re crisp on the outside while still warm and soft on the inside.

FAQ About Tortilla Cinnamon Rolls

1. Can I use regular flour tortillas instead of gluten-free ones?

Yes, you can definitely use regular flour tortillas in place of gluten-free ones. The recipe works well with any type of tortilla, so feel free to use whichever you have on hand.

2. How do I store leftover tortilla cinnamon rolls?

To store leftover rolls, place them in an airtight container and refrigerate them for up to 2 days. When you’re ready to enjoy them, reheat in a skillet for a few minutes on low heat to bring back their crispy texture.

3. Can I make tortilla cinnamon rolls 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the rolls ahead of time by assembling them and storing them in the fridge before cooking. When ready to serve, just cook them in the skillet as usual for a quick and easy treat.

Description

Tortilla cinnamon rolls are a simple yet delicious dessert made with tortillas, cream cheese, cinnamon sugar, and butter. With a crispy exterior and a sweet, creamy center, they offer the perfect balance of textures and flavors in just a few minutes.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 flour tortillas (gluten free, paleo, or regular will work), slightly warmed
  • 46 tbsp cream cheese (regular or vegan)
  • 1/2 tbsp coconut sugar, plus more for sprinkling
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on, plus more for sprinkling
  • 1 tsp butter (vegan or regular)
  • Maple syrup for dipping

Instructions

  1. In a small bowl, mix the coconut sugar and the cinnamon. Set aside for the final step.
  2. Gently warm your tortillas on the stove (just for a couple of seconds to make them more flexible).
  3. Spread each tortilla with 2–3 tbsp of cream cheese, covering the whole surface.
  4. Sprinkle the cream cheese layer with a good amount of cinnamon and coconut sugar (not from the mixture you made; this will be used later).
  5. Gently roll the tortillas up tightly, then use a sharp knife to slice into smaller bite-sized roll ups.
  6. Heat a pan over medium-low heat with the butter. Once hot, add the roll ups and cook for 2–3 minutes per side, until crispy and slightly golden.
  7. Dip each roll up in the cinnamon sugar mixture (make sure each piece has some butter on it from the pan to help the mixture stick).
  8. Serve with maple syrup and enjoy!

Notes

  • Don’t overheat the tortillas – warming them just enough will make them pliable for rolling.
  • For a dairy-free or vegan version, use vegan cream cheese and butter.
  • If you prefer a sweeter roll, sprinkle extra cinnamon sugar on the outside after cooking.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days and reheat in a pan for the best texture.
